Troocoo have been engaged to source 2 Senior Application Packaging Engineers for our Federal Government client who will be responsible for undertaking Application Packaging in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ager and Intune for distribution to the required desktop and server endpoints.
The successful candidates will work under the limited direction of senior staff, exercise both initiative and judgement in the interpretation of policy, and in the application of practices and procedures.
The primary technologies will be Windows Server, Windows Desktop, Applications Packager, Rapid 7, and Broadcom Data Centre Security Engineer.
Key Responsibilities:
- Automate the installation and configuration of Windows applications (package), configure security patch delivery, Windows feature updates, drivers, language packs, and vulnerability fixes for both windows servers and desktop in a format compatible with Intune and SCCM.
- Design, develop, coordinate, and manage Application Packaging projects.
- Package applications and software updates using a scripting language.
- Conduct Root Cause Analysis and remediation efforts on major Windows Application Packaging and deployments.
- Diagnose Windows application deployment issues and coordinate package improvements/fixes.
Prior experience in a similar role is imperative, as decision making is substantially dependent on judgement, skills and knowledge. You will manage and organise your own work in the context of competing priorities, including contributing to business planning, changes in workplace practices and business improvement strategies. This position requires a minimum Negative Vetting Security Clearance.
